Base Station Analysers Market Outlook
The global base station analysers market is projected to reach a valuation of approximately USD 800 million by 2035, growing at a compound annual growth rate (CAGR) of around 8.5% during the forecast period from 2025 to 2035. This substantial growth can be attributed to the increasing demand for efficient communication systems, the rapid expansion of telecommunication networks, and the rising adoption of 5G technology. As mobile network operators strive to enhance network performance and improve service quality, the need for advanced testing and analysis equipment such as base station analysers will significantly elevate. Additionally, the growing emphasis on public safety communication and the burgeoning demand for broadcast services are expected to contribute positively to market dynamics. Furthermore, the increasing complexities associated with network architectures are driving organizations to invest in sophisticated analysers to ensure operational efficiency and reliability.

By Product Type
Portable Base Station Analysers:
Portable base station analysers are gaining popularity due to their ease of use and mobility, making them ideal for field testing applications. These devices are lightweight and compact, allowing technicians to perform tests on-site without the need for bulky equipment. With the growing demand for quick and reliable testing in various environments, portable analysers support multiple measurement functions, including signal quality, interference analysis, and coverage mapping. Their ability to deliver precise measurements in real-time enables telecom companies to troubleshoot issues promptly and enhance service delivery, making them a cornerstone in the base station analysers market.
Benchtop Base Station Analysers:
Benchtop base station analysers are primarily used in laboratories and testing facilities for comprehensive analysis of telecommunications equipment. These analysers provide high precision and extensive measurement capabilities, catering to complex testing requirements. They often come equipped with advanced features like spectrum analysis, modulation analysis, and protocol decoding, making them suitable for R&D and product development processes. The demand for benchtop models is driven by their ability to support multi-band and multi-technology testing, essential for evolving telecom standards and ensuring compliance with regulations.
Handheld Base Station Analysers:
Handheld base station analysers offer a blend of portability and functionality, making them ideal for technicians who require flexibility and ease of operation in various settings. These devices are equipped with user-friendly interfaces, enabling quick access to vital parameters and measurement results. As networks become increasingly complex, handheld analysers allow field engineers to perform on-the-spot diagnostics and adjustments, ensuring networks operate at optimal levels. The growing emphasis on maintaining service quality in competitive markets is driving the demand for handheld analysers, as they facilitate rapid troubleshooting and maintenance in the field.
Networked Base Station Analysers:
Networked base station analysers are designed for comprehensive monitoring and testing of interconnected network systems, making them essential tools for large-scale telecom operators. These devices enable continuous data collection and real-time analysis across multiple base stations, facilitating proactive network management. With the shift towards more integrated telecom operations, networked analysers provide granular insights into network performance, allowing operators to identify issues before they impact service quality. Their ability to integrate with existing network management systems is a key driver of adoption in the base station analysers market.
Rack-Mount Base Station Analysers:
Rack-mount base station analysers are ideal for stationary installations within data centers and testing environments, providing robust performance and scalability. These devices are typically designed to handle extensive testing workloads and can facilitate simultaneous measurements across multiple channels. Their modular nature allows users to customize configurations based on specific testing needs, enhancing operational efficiency. As the demand for high-capacity networks continues to rise, rack-mount analysers are increasingly being utilized by telecom operators and service providers to ensure compliance and optimize performance in centralized environments.
By Application
Telecommunication:
The telecommunication sector accounts for a significant share of the base station analysers market, driven by the increasing complexity of network infrastructures and the transition to advanced communication technologies such as 5G. Telecom operators require precise testing tools to ensure their networks provide reliable and high-quality services, which is critical to maintaining a competitive edge. Base station analysers enable operators to conduct various tests, including signal strength, quality assessments, and interference measurements, ensuring optimal network performance. As the telecom industry continues to evolve, the demand for sophisticated testing solutions is anticipated to grow substantially.
Broadcasting:
In the broadcasting sector, base station analysers play a crucial role in ensuring that transmission quality is maintained across various frequencies and distances. These devices facilitate the monitoring of broadcast signals and help identify any disruptions or inconsistencies that could affect audio and visual quality. As the demand for high-definition broadcasting increases, the need for precise and reliable signal testing becomes paramount. Base station analysers thus serve as essential tools for broadcasters aiming to enhance transmission quality while complying with regulatory standards in diverse environments.
Public Safety:
Public safety applications require robust communication systems that can operate under critical conditions. Base station analysers are vital in this sector as they ensure that emergency communication networks function optimally, especially during disasters or emergencies. These devices allow for thorough testing and monitoring of public safety communications to guarantee reliable connectivity for first responders and essential services. With the increasing emphasis on improving public safety infrastructure, the demand for base station analysers in this segment is expected to grow, driven by government initiatives and technological advancements.
Military:
The military sector places a high premium on reliable communication systems, which necessitate the use of advanced testing and monitoring tools such as base station analysers. These devices ensure that military communication networks can withstand various operational challenges and maintain performance under adverse conditions. Base station analysers are essential for verifying the integrity and security of military communications, allowing for seamless coordination and response during critical missions. The growing defense budgets worldwide and the focus on enhancing military capabilities are expected to positively impact the demand for these testing solutions in the military application segment.

By Connectivity Type
Wired Base Station Analysers:
Wired base station analysers are favored for their ability to provide stable and high-quality measurements without interference from external signals. These devices are ideal for environments where reliability and precision are paramount, such as data centers or laboratory settings. Wired analysers offer robust connectivity options, enabling them to interface seamlessly with various network devices and systems. Their ability to deliver accurate and consistent performance in controlled settings makes them indispensable for telecom operators and engineers focused on ensuring optimal network performance and compliance with industry standards.
Wireless Base Station Analysers:
Wireless base station analysers are gaining traction due to their flexibility and ease of use in dynamic environments. These devices facilitate quick and easy testing of wireless networks, allowing technicians to move freely without being restricted by cables. Wireless analysers are crucial for field applications where rapid deployment and mobility are essential. They enable real-time monitoring of signal quality and performance, which is critical for maintaining service quality in evolving network architectures. The growing demand for mobile communication solutions is driving the adoption of wireless base station analysers across various sectors.
Hybrid Base Station Analysers:
Hybrid base station analysers combine the features of both wired and wireless models, offering versatility in testing capabilities. These devices can operate in various environments, catering to the needs of technicians who require flexibility in their testing processes. Hybrid analysers are particularly advantageous in scenarios where both types of connectivity are necessary, allowing engineers to assess performance comprehensively. As the telecom sector continues to evolve, the demand for hybrid solutions that can seamlessly transition between wired and wireless testing is expected to grow, enhancing overall operational efficiency.
By Region
The North American region dominates the base station analysers market, accounting for approximately 35% of the global market share in 2025. The robust telecom infrastructure, significant investments in digital transformation, and the rapid adoption of 5G technology contribute to the region's leadership. Major telecom operators are continually upgrading their networks to enhance capabilities and service quality, which is expected to drive the demand for base station analysers. Moreover, the presence of key market players and advanced technological developments in the region further solidify its position as a critical market for base station analysers.
In Europe, the base station analysers market is anticipated to grow at a CAGR of 7.8% from 2025 to 2035, driven by the rising focus on integrated communication systems and regulatory requirements for network performance. The European market is characterized by a strong emphasis on research and development, leading to continuous innovation in testing equipment. The growing demand for reliable public safety communication systems and increased investment in telecommunications infrastructure are expected to further contribute to market growth in this region.
